Ingredients

To create this mouthwatering Costco Chicken Alfredo recipe, you’ll need the following ingredients:

For the chicken

  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Olive oil for cooking

For the Alfredo sauce

  • 4 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 2 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• Salt and pepper to taste

For the Pasta

  • 1 pound fettuccine or any pasta of your choice
  • Salt for boiling water

Instructions

Follow these step-by-step instructions to prepare your Costco Chicken Alfredo:

  1. Begin by cooking the chicken. Both sides of chicken breasts should be seasoned with salt and pepper. In a skillet over medium-high heat add a drizzle of olive oil to heat. Cook the chicken breasts for about 6-7 minutes per side or until cooked through. Remove from heat and set aside to cool. Once cooled, slice the chicken into thin strips.
  2. Use a large pot add up water and boil it. Add salt to the boiling water and cook the pasta according to the package instructions until al dente. Drain the cooked pasta using a strainer or colander, and set aside.
  3. While the pasta is cooking, prepare the Alfredo sauce. In the same skillet used to cook the chicken, melt the butter over medium heat. Sauté by adding minced garlic for about a minute until fragrant.
  4. Pour the heavy cream into the skillet with the melted butter and garlic. By stirring properly bring the mixture to a simmer. Allow it to simmer for about 2-3 minutes, until it slightly thickens.
  5. Reduce the heat to low and gradually whisk in the grated Parmesan cheese. Continue whisking until the cheese has melted and the sauce is smooth and creamy.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  6. Add the cooked pasta and sliced chicken to the skillet with the Alfredo sauce. Toss everything together gently until the pasta and chicken are coated evenly with the sauce.
  7. Remove the skillet from heat and let the flavors meld for a couple of minutes.

FAQs

Should I use pre-cooked chicken for this recipe?

To save time you can use pre-cooked chicken. Simply skip the step of cooking the chicken and proceed with slicing it into thin strips.

Can I use a different type of pasta?

Absolutely! While fettuccine is traditionally used in Alfredo dishes, you can experiment with other pasta varieties such as penne, linguine, or even spaghetti.

Can I add vegetables to this recipe?

Certainly! You can incorporate vegetables like broccoli florets, sliced mushrooms, or roasted bell peppers to add more flavor and nutritional value to the dish. Simply cook the vegetables separately and add them to the skillet along with the pasta and chicken.

Make this recipe ahead of time, recommended?

While it’s best to enjoy the Costco Chicken Alfredo immediately after preparation, you can make the Alfredo sauce ahead of time and refrigerate it for up to 24 hours. When ready to serve, reheat the sauce gently on the stovetop and cook the pasta and chicken as instructed.
